> As long as we're on the subject, how would one provide a "patch" for
> adding a completely new file like the Emacs mode pamphlet? Is there
> some preferred way to do this or is just supplying the file and target
> directory for inclusion enough?
>
Tim clearly wants us to use 'diff -Naur'. The -N option to diff
means that it will include new files in the patch.
Another possibility is to artificially create an empty file in
the old tree (may be easier than cleaning trash files in the new
tree).
What is preferred depends on persons. For me, a single file +
location is good enough, for multiple files patch is preferred.
